The Role

You will advise clients on all aspects of planning and highways law, including:

  • Providing strategic advice on securing planning permission and risk management
  • Drafting and negotiating complex statutory and highways agreements, including s.106 agreements and land development agreements
  • Conducting detailed planning due diligence on real estate, funding, and corporate transactions
  • Advising on judicial reviews, enforcement matters, appeals, and committee hearings
  • Handling specialist planning issues such as special protection areas, Assets of Community Value, and Village Greens
  • Advising on highways law, CIL, EIA, and GLA planning matters

The role offers the chance to manage your own caseload while working alongside senior colleagues on significant development projects.
